
Judah has been a core character (show writer Frank Rossitano) in the Emmy Award Winning 30 Rock since 2006, proving to the masses what many have long known to be true: he is one of his generation’s major comic acting talents. Judah’s rock star status among America’s youth blossomed out of being ‘The Hug Guy’ in the Dave Mathew’s Band video Everyday, entertaining his fans with stand-up performances and guest appearances on MTV’s Beach House, The Late Show with David Letterman, and frequent slots on VH 1’s Best Week Ever.
Judah’s heartbreaking, darkly funny portrayal of Toby Radloff in American Splendor earned him a “Best Supporting Actor” nomination at the Independent Spirit awards and was our first indicator that within Judah, there lay a nuanced actor who could summon not just the humor, but the pain of being Elias.
